The School of Natural and Social Sciences includes the departments of Behavioral Sciences, Biology, Chemistry/Physics, and Mathematics. It also houses the Allied Health program.

The Vision of the School of Natural and Social Sciences is to utilize the philosophy and methods of science to promote understanding of how the physical world is composed and related to the properties and behaviors of plant, animal, and human life. Students are challenged to integrate the logic of rational certainty with the logic of faith and conviction.

With this vision in mind, each year the School of Natural and Social Sciences hosts a Student Research Forum in which students from each department present their current research to the faculty and student body. In April of 2006, about 70 students gave poster presentations while 5 students gave oral presentations.
